<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
Blackrock CA Insured 2008      CU               09247g108      917    55400 SH       SOLE                    55400
Insured Municipal Income Fund  CU               45809F104     3201   229000 SH       SOLE                   229000
Morgan Stanley Calif Qlty Muni CU               61745p635      455    33900 SH       SOLE                    33900
Muni Holdings CA Insured Fund, CU               625933106     2157   152200 SH       SOLE                   152200
Muni Holdings NY Insured Fund, CU               625931100      551    39000 SH       SOLE                    39000
Muniyield Michigan Insured Fun CU               62630j106      277    19000 SH       SOLE                    19000
Muniyield NY Fd. Inc.          CU               626301105      134    10000 SH       SOLE                    10000
Aberdeen Asia-Pacific Prime In CI               003009107     2137   433400 SH       SOLE                   433400
Blackrock 2004 Invest Qual Ter CI               09247j102     4585   484200 SH       SOLE                   484200
Blackrock Income Opportunity T CI               092475102     3991   366800 SH       SOLE                   366800
MFS Government Markets Income  CI               552939100     4106   596000 SH       SOLE                   596000
Abbott Labs                    COM              002824100     1794 47688.00 SH       SOLE                 47688.00
American Express               COM              025816109      259  7800.00 SH       SOLE                  7800.00
Bankamerica Corp               COM              060505104      470  7025.00 SH       SOLE                  7025.00
Barrick Gold Corp.             COM              067901108     2097 134746.00SH       SOLE                134746.00
Bristol Myers Squibb           COM              110122108      697 32995.00 SH       SOLE                 32995.00
ChevronTexaco Corp.            COM              166764100      648 10024.00 SH       SOLE                 10024.00
Cisco Systems                  COM              17275r102      206 15870.00 SH       SOLE                 15870.00
Coca Cola                      COM              191216100      250  6177.00 SH       SOLE                  6177.00
Dell Computer                  COM              247025109      210  7700.00 SH       SOLE                  7700.00
EMC Corp. Mass.                COM              268648102       73 10153.00 SH       SOLE                 10153.00
Exxon Mobil Corp.              COM              30231g102     2235 63944.00 SH       SOLE                 63944.00
General Electric Co            COM              369604103     2218 87000.00 SH       SOLE                 87000.00
Intel Corp                     COM              458140100      213 13100.00 SH       SOLE                 13100.00
Johnson & Johnson Inc          COM              478160104     2024 34980.00 SH       SOLE                 34980.00
Kinder Morgan Management, LLC  COM              49455u100     2004 61955.02 SH       SOLE                 61955.02
Logic Devices, Inc.            COM              541402103       18 17900.00 SH       SOLE                 17900.00
Lucent Technologies            COM              549463107       33 22492.00 SH       SOLE                 22492.00
Main Street & Main Inc. New    COM              560345308        9 10530.00 SH       SOLE                 10530.00
Medtronic Inc                  COM              585055106      298  6600.00 SH       SOLE                  6600.00
Mera Pharmaceuticals, Inc.     COM              58732r103        2 60000.00 SH       SOLE                 60000.00
Merck & Co Inc                 COM              589331107     4930 90000.00 SH       SOLE                 90000.00
Microsoft                      COM              594918104      249 10280.00 SH       SOLE                 10280.00
Newmont Mining Corporation     COM              651639106     2390 91400.00 SH       SOLE                 91400.00
Oracle Corporation             COM              68389x105      669 61659.00 SH       SOLE                 61659.00
Pfizer Inc.                    COM              717081103      206  6625.00 SH       SOLE                  6625.00
Proctor & Gamble               COM              742718109     2279 25590.00 SH       SOLE                 25590.00
RateXchange Corporation        COM              754091106        4 20000.00 SH       SOLE                 20000.00
Schering-Plough Corp           COM              806605101     1081 60604.00 SH       SOLE                 60604.00
Starbucks Corp.                COM              855244109      588 22840.00 SH       SOLE                 22840.00
U.S. Bancorp New               COM              902973304     1459 76853.00 SH       SOLE                 76853.00
Verizon Communications         COM              92343v104      249  7038.00 SH       SOLE                  7038.00
Wal-Mart Stores Inc            COM              931142103      291  5600.00 SH       SOLE                  5600.00
Wyeth                          COM              983024100     1014 26800.00 SH       SOLE                 26800.00
Buckeye Partners LP            LTD              118230101     2313 64368.00 SH       SOLE                 64368.00
El Paso Energy Partners LP     LTD              28368b102     2087 67250.00 SH       SOLE                 67250.00
Enbridge Energy Partners LP    LTD              29250r106      411  9000.00 SH       SOLE                  9000.00
Kinder Morgan Energy Partners  LTD              494550106     1310 35400.00 SH       SOLE                 35400.00
Northern Border Partners LP    LTD              664785102     1632 42700.00 SH       SOLE                 42700.00
Penn Virginia Resource Partner LTD              707884102     1283 53550.00 SH       SOLE                 53550.00
Teppco Partners, L.P.          LTD              872384102      886 28000.00 SH       SOLE                 28000.00
Royce Opportunity Fd. #249     MF               780905832       97 13979.1740SH      SOLE               13979.1740
Vanguard GNMA Fd.              MF               922031307      416 38772.0570SH      SOLE               38772.0570
Govt. Secs. Income Fund, GNMA  UT               383743499        1 45085.000SH       SOLE                45085.000
</TABLE>